The grapes for the Barolo Brunate come from approximately 40-year-old vines from the historic Brunate vineyard in La Morra.
Goes well with red meat, roasts and game.
Intense ruby red. Dry, with a generous body, harmoniously balanced and velvety texture. Classic, ripe red fruits, long finish, rich and very elegant. Notes of plum and intense tar, very typical of the Brunate vineyards.
